Job description

About Petstock Group

Join an enthusiastic team where the love for pets and animals inspires personal and professional growth, making a meaningful impact on Pets, People, and the Planet. Petstock is committed to fostering a work environment that encourages inclusivity, family values, and passion for animals.

Perks and Benefits

  • Award-winning career development programs including a new leadership initiative
  • Comprehensive benefits for team members, their families, and pets across Petstock Group & Woolworths Group
  • Complimentary access to mental health, financial, and wellbeing resources
  • Free access to Sonder, a wellbeing and safety support service
  • Opportunities to engage in sustainability projects, community partnerships, and the Petstock Foundation
  • Option to purchase up to two weeks of additional paid leave and receive four weeks of paid parental leave
  • Access to discounted health and wellness services and exclusive workplace banking offers

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ead, mentor, and inspire the store team to consistently deliver outstanding customer experiences
  • Assist the Store Manager in coaching staff to improve knowledge and skills
  • Maintain a strong safety culture, promoting Work Health & Safety standards among the team
  • Help manage stock with accuracy and ensure adherence to stock integrity procedures
  • Support visual merchandising standards to keep stock displays attractive and consistent
  • Keep updated on pet care knowledge, products, and services actively
  • Recruit, onboard, and induct high-quality new team members
  • Cultivate a fun, supportive workplace culture to make coming to work enjoyable
  • Engage with local marketing initiatives and sponsorship opportunities

Candidate Requirements

  • Previous experience in a similar store leadership role or readiness to advance in retail management
  • Proven motivation to meet and exceed sales targets
  • Strong leadership skills with the ability to motivate and develop high-performing teams while fostering a positive culture
  • Effective prioritisation and time management skills in a dynamic environment
  • Commitment to promoting safe Work Health & Safety practices
  • Sound business acumen and adaptability to change
  • Excellent interpersonal skills to build rapport with customers and team members
